What you'll do

  • Own application and product security: threat modeling, secure design review, and secure code review.
  • Enforce and tune GitHub Advanced Security (CodeQL, secret scanning, push protection) as required status checks.
  • Design and own the security architecture for our agentic SDLC.
  • Build and run non-human identity (NHI) and secrets management at scale.
  • Secure our AWS environment: IAM/IC, network segmentation, logging, configuration baselines, encryption, and workload protection across S3, EKS and Terraform.

What they require

  • 6+ years in security engineering, with demonstrated depth in application/product security and cloud security (AWS).
  • Hands-on with secure SDLC tooling: SAST/DAST, GitHub Advanced Security / CodeQL, secret scanning, and software supply-chain / dependency security.
  • Strong in identity and access management: Okta, OAuth/OIDC, SAML, phishing-resistant MFA, and the management of non-human identities and secrets (e.g., AWS Secrets Manager, or equivalents).
  • Familiarity with — or genuine drive to go deep on — securing AI/LLM and agentic systems: prompt injection, agent authorization and over-permissioning, NHI sprawl, and model/supply-chain risk.
  • Working knowledge of the HIPAA Security Rule, SOC 2, and the NIST Cybersecurity Framework.
